Abstract

Genetic and phenotypic parameters of traits related to growth, production and reproduction are crucial in the formulation of successful breeding programmes. Given the diversity in the cattle population of India, meta-analysis offers a comprehensive insight into the overall performance of the crossbred population for the efficient implementation of animal improvement programmes. The present study aimed to undertake meta-analysis and estimate the genetic and phenotypic parameters of performance traits in Indian crossbred cattle. A total of 130 articles were included in this study after data editing and quality control. The heterogeneity index reached 91.2% for phenotypic parameters, 99.4% for heritability estimates, and 99.4% for phenotypic correlations. Pooled least squares mean ranged from 20.54 to 25.84 kg for body weight at birth, 1542.05 to 2691.44 kg for first lactation milk yield, 996.05 to 1259.38 days for age at first calving in crossbred cattle. Pooled heritability estimates ranged from 0.13 to 0.69 for growth traits, 0.09 to 0.76 for production traits, and 0.05 to 0.25 for reproduction traits. The pooled repeatability estimates were moderate and ranged from 0.22 to 0.42. Pooled genetic correlations were positive and ranged from 0.09 to 0.97. This is the first attempt to estimate the genetic and phenotypic parameters of performance traits in Indian crossbred cattle using a meta-analytical approach. Meta-analysis revealed that the heritability estimate of production and reproduction performance was low to moderate in all the crossbred populations. This suggested the influence of environment and other non-additive genetic effects, wherein improvement is possible through the integration of effective selection and optimum management strategies. Pooled estimates of genetic and phenotypic parameters from this investigation may be used for the effective implementation of breeding programmes in the herds/populations, where these parameters are not estimated/available for any reason.
